About White Bolivian People

White Bolivians comprise approximately 5-12% of the population (estimates vary across surveys; the 2012 INE census did not enumerate the category separately and self-identification estimates come from Latinobarómetro and other survey sources). The community traces ancestry primarily to Spanish colonial settlement and to 19th-20th c. immigration from Spain, Italy, Croatia, Germany, and the Levant. Concentrated in Santa Cruz, Tarija, Sucre, La Paz, and Cochabamba. The Croatian-Bolivian community of Santa Cruz and the Mennonite-Bolivian community (separately enumerated) are culturally distinct. President Gonzalo Sánchez de Lozada and others have come from the white-Bolivian elite.
